Description
Under the direction of the Hockey Academy Coordinator, the position of Hockey Academy Coach is responsible for providing instruction, direction, and safety to all students in a particular Hockey Academy class. This position is also responsible for subbing or aiding in other classes as well as assisting with all other Hockey Academy functions and special events.
Essential Functions:
- Understand and comply with all Park District and Hockey Academy Program policies, rules and regulations.
- Become familiar with the structure and organization of Hockey Academy including class descriptions and general information.
- Provide level specific instruction to participants based upon current Park District and Hockey Academy standards.
- Complete all paperwork as assigned including, but not limited to, attendance sheets, mid-season evaluations, and end of season evaluations.
- Begin and end all classes on time.
- Arrive at the rink no less than 20 minutes before class. Be ready and greeting students for class no less than five minutes before classes begins
- Limit absences from class responsibilities. Secure substitutes when needed and complete all required paperwork in advance of missing class.
- Attend all required pre-season trainings and in season meetings.
Knowledge, Skill and Work Experience:
- Participation in previous hockey program
- Strong skating abilities
- Completion of all in-house pre-season trainings (done after hire)
- Availability to work within Hockey Academy times. (Wednesday evenings, Saturday afternoons, Sunday mid-day).
- Certification in advanced Cardio Pulmonary Resuscitation (CPR), First Aid and Automated External Defibrillator (AED) within 1 month of employment and keep certification current. The District provides this training.
